The bible tells us to love our neighbours and also to love our enemies; probably because they are generally the same people.
- G. K. Chesterton

Always telling the truth is no doubt better than always lying, although equally pathological.
- Robert Brault

It is a truth universally acknowledged that a single man in possession of a good fortune must be in want of a wife.
- Jane Austen

Find a woman who makes you feel more alive. She won't make life perfect but she'll make it infinitely more interesting. And then love her with all that's in you.
- Gayle G. Roper

The difference between love and happiness is that those who talk about love tend to be in love, but those who talk about happiness tend to be not happy.
- Nassim Nicholas Taleb

I wanted to write the most beautiful poem but that is impossible; the world has written its own.
- Dejan Stojanović
